Johnston City nips A-J 60-59

Anna-Jonesboro missed a last-second shot in a 60-59 loss to Johnston City Monday, Nov. 26, in first-round action in high school boys’ basketball tournament action at Goreville.

The Indians made several fourth quarter free throws to spoil the Wildcats’ season-opener.

The Wildcats led 21-17 after one quarter, but the Indians fought back to tie the game 32-32 at halftime.

Johnston City led 49-43 heading into the fourth quarter.

Tyler Vaughn led A-J with 14 points and 3 rebounds.

Ben McFarland added 11 points and 8 rebounds. Noah Fuller had 11 points and 2 rebounds.

Colton James and Zach Parr each scored 8 points. Jay Kemp had 4 points and 7 rebounds. Damian Reed had 3 points and 5 rebounds.

The Wildcats were 7 of 10 from 3-point range, 16 of 34 from 2-point range and 6 of 9 at the free throw line.
